Calculating the Ramp's Incline and Safety Measures

Determining the Incline Angle

To understand how steep the ramp is, we use trigonometry:
    • Identify the height difference between the ground and the truck bed (h).
    • Use the ramp length (L = 6.12m) to calculate the angle (θ):

\[
\sin \theta = \frac{h}{L}
\]


  • If the truck bed is, for example, 1 meter high:


\[
\sin \theta = \frac{1}{6.12} \approx 0.1634
\]
\[
\theta \approx \arcsin(0.1634) \approx 9.4^\circ
\]

A gentle incline (less than 15 degrees) is preferred for safe loading.

Frequently Asked Questions

What is the purpose of calculating the incline of the ramp when loading the PS5 container onto the truck?
Calculating the incline helps determine the safety and effort required to move the container, ensuring the ramp is suitable and preventing accidents during loading.
How can I find the angle of the ramp used to load the container?
Using the height and length of the ramp, you can apply trigonometry: angle = arcsin(height / length).
What is the force required to push the container up the ramp if friction is negligible?
The force equals the component of the container's weight parallel to the ramp, calculated as weight × sin(angle).
How does friction between the container and the ramp affect the effort needed to load the PS5 container?
Friction increases the required force, so additional force must overcome both gravity and friction to move the container.
What safety precautions should be taken when loading a heavy container like this onto a truck?
Ensure the ramp is stable and secure, use proper lifting techniques or equipment, and wear appropriate safety gear to prevent accidents.
How much work is done in moving the container up the ramp?
Work is calculated as the force applied times the distance moved along the ramp, considering both gravity and friction if present.
